About Boardman Group Camp

Set along the Stillaguamish River and framed by the rugged beauty of the Mt. Baker-Snoqualmie National Forest, Boardman Group Camp offers a balance of natural solitude and convenient accessibility. This single-site, group-oriented campground accommodates up to 35 people and provides a tranquil retreat for those seeking to immerse themselves in the outdoors without venturing too far off the beaten path. The river's soothing flow offsets occasional highway noises from the nearby Mountain Loop Scenic Byway, enhancing the serene ambiance.

The campground features essentials like picnic tables, campfire rings with grills, and vault toilets, but visitors must bring their own drinking water as none is provided on-site. With ample space for RVs, tents, and trailers, it caters to small and medium groups looking to enjoy camping, fishing, or hiking in the surrounding forest. The natural surroundings include old-growth forests and mossy riverbanks, ideal for reconnecting with nature.

Located just 16 miles east of Granite Falls and accessible via a scenic drive, the campground places visitors near numerous outdoor attractions. Hiking trails, fishing spots in the Stillaguamish River, and the charm of the nearby Verlot Public Service Center are all within easy reach, making it a perfect destination for weekend getaways or group gatherings.
